iMethods named as Best Staffing Company 2019

April 23, 2019

Award Recognizes Outstanding Employers in the Staffing Industry

iMethods received a 2019 Best Staffing Company award from Staffing Industry Analysts (SIA), the global advisor on staffing and workforce solutions. The organization recognizes employers for their top performance in engaging and deploying talent. The winners were recognized at SIA’s 28th annual Executive Forum North America, held in February at the JW Marriott in Austin, TX.

iMethods was among the companies that scored in the top quartile in each of the award categories. The categories comprise North American firms with 10 to 20 internal employees, firms with 21 to 50 internal employees, firms with 51 to 200 employees, firms with 201-500 employees, and firms with over 501 employees; smaller and larger UK firms; and Best Staffing Company to Temp/Contract for. The Best Staffing Firms to Work For awards are sponsored by Monster Worldwide, Inc. (NYSE: MWW).

Approximately 400 firms sought participation in the program this year, which was conducted by SIA in conjunction with Quantum Workplace, an Omaha, NE-based company. Internal employees at each firm were asked to complete a 40-question online survey that measured 10 key engagement categories focusing on items including teamwork, trust in senior leaders, feeling valued, manager effectiveness, compensation and benefits. There is no charge for participation and companies completing the survey receive a report highlighting their firm’s results.

In order to gather statistically sound results, participating companies must have reached a minimum level of employee participation, based on their total number of employees. Companies were ranked in each size category according to their overall score. Winners were chosen based entirely on survey results.
